またがる
"またがる" means "to straddle" or "to span."
In this context, 'またがる' conveys the meaning of extending over a period, referring to time or duration.
彼の計画は三ヶ月にまたがる。
His plan spans three months.
In this sentence, 'またがる' functions to describe the act of sitting astride or mounting, particularly onto a horse.
馬にまたがるのが難しいです。
It's difficult to mount a horse.
